Roborobo! a Fast Robot Simulator for Swarm and Collective Robotics

04/10/2013
by   Nicolas Bredeche, et al.
0

Roborobo! is a multi-platform, highly portable, robot simulator for large-scale collective robotics experiments. Roborobo! is coded in C++, and follows the KISS guideline ("Keep it simple"). Therefore, its external dependency is solely limited to the widely available SDL library for fast 2D Graphics. Roborobo! is based on a Khepera/ePuck model. It is targeted for fast single and multi-robots simulation, and has already been used in more than a dozen published research mainly concerned with evolutionary swarm robotics, including environment-driven self-adaptation and distributed evolutionary optimization, as well as online onboard embodied evolution and embodied morphogenesis.

READ FULL TEXT

page 1

page 2

research
09/26/2017

Embodied Evolution in Collective Robotics: A Review

This paper provides an overview of evolutionary robotics techniques appl...
research
08/24/2023

Potato: A Data-Oriented Programming 3D Simulator for Large-Scale Heterogeneous Swarm Robotics

Large-scale simulation with realistic nonlinear dynamic models is crucia...
research
05/27/2019

ColCOSΦ: A Multiple Pheromone Communication System for Swarm Robotics and Social Insects Research

In the last few decades we have witnessed how the pheromone of social in...
research
06/30/2014

Navigating Robot Swarms Using Collective Intelligence Learned from Golden Shiner Fish

Navigating networked robot swarms often requires knowing where to go, se...
research
10/11/2018

Towards the Targeted Environment-Specific Evolution of Robot Components

This research considers the task of evolving the physical structure of a...
research
02/27/2019

Achieving Non-Uniform Densities in Vibration Driven Robot Swarms Using Phase Separation Theory

In robot swarms operating with severely constrained sensing and communic...
research
10/13/2018

A Decentralized Mobile Computing Network for Multi-Robot Systems Operations

Collective animal behaviors are paradigmatic examples of fully decentral...

Please sign up or login with your details

Forgot password? Click here to reset